WebNov 10, 2010 · Find the screws behind the bulbs in each headlight. The precise location and how to adjust them does, however, depend on your car. The screws will always be in the same general location, however. Use the screws to adjust the beams by raising them or lowering them as required. There are two torx 15 bolts to adjust the left right or up down level of the lights. Top bolt is for left right and you turn counter clockwise to move the light beam in toward center.

Open the hood. 2. stand in front of the driver's side headlight. 3. look down. --> you should see the headlight assembly - what you have in the picture. 4. locate the adjustment screw (red arrow on picture) 5. insert a Philips screwdriver vertically. 6. carefully turn the adjustment screw to lift / lower the beam.
